Nodeva Enterprise data centers are purpose-built to handle the unique demands of artificial intelligence workloads, providing the power density, cooling capacity, and network throughput required for sustained AI training operations.
High-Density Power
Nodeva Enterprise provides power supply support ranging from 3kW to over 30kW per rack, with customizable PDU configurations and flexible power redundancy levels designed specifically for GPU clusters and AI training rigs.
- Power Range3kW - 30kW+
- RedundancyN+1 / 2N
- Uptime SLA99.99%
Advanced Cooling Systems
Our facilities employ high-performance HVAC systems supporting hot/cold aisle isolation structures, equipped with chillers, row-level cooling, and liquid cooling systems to maintain optimal temperatures under sustained AI compute loads.
- ArchitectureHot/Cold Aisle
- Liquid CoolingAvailable
- PUE Target< 1.3
Network Performance
Carrier-neutral network infrastructure with multi-operator BGP access, international dedicated line docking, and Internet Exchange node connections ensure low-latency data transfer for distributed AI training across multiple nodes.
- NetworkMulti-BGP
- IX AccessDirect Peering
- LatencySub-millisecond

Data Sovereignty and Security
Training AI models requires processing vast amounts of proprietary data. Nodeva Enterprise ensures your training data and model weights remain under your complete control through physical security, network isolation, and vendor-neutral architecture that prevents any third party from accessing your intellectual property.
Multiple access control systems including biometric authentication, video surveillance with 180+ day retention, and cage isolation options provide defense-in-depth for your most sensitive AI assets.
